Output 893c55ef1b82e0903ccf7a69dfab44ec06922ef8bbe75ef1ed1b8670256c5521:12

value
46931000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1be9655276e6ebd057e27c32728a8e6230d52899 OP_EQUAL
address
34EbmM5KtWBU68ps8PBoQjnvJdx4jDqjd7
transaction
893c55ef1b82e0903ccf7a69dfab44ec06922ef8bbe75ef1ed1b8670256c5521
confirmations
355692
spent
true